Tax Specialist Salaries
How much do Tax Specialist earn in Australia? The average salary of Tax Specialist is $105,000 in Australia
$105,000 /yr
Additional Cash Compensation Information Icon
Average $105,000
Range $105K - $105K
Last updated May 10 2024
The average pay range for Tax Specialist is between $105K and $105K. Salaries vary from a low of $100K up to $110K per year. The average number of Tax Specialist roles advertised per month is 1 in Australia between May 2023 and May 2024.

How many years does it take to become a Tax Specialist?
Most candidates undertake an average of 8 years Accounting prior to being appointed as a Tax Specialist.
Average Accounting required to become a Tax Specialist
Last updated May 11 2024
Most candidates have on average 11 years working experience prior to becoming a Tax Specialist.
